Product Overview
The SN74LS390N is a 4bit dual decade counter contains eight flip-flops and additional gating to implement two individual four-bit counters. It incorporates dual divide-by-two and divide-by-five counter, which can be used to implement cycle lengths equal to any whole and/or cumulative multiples of 2 and/or 5 up to divide-by-100. When connected as a bi-quinary counter, the separate divide-by-two circuit can be used to provide symmetry (a square wave) at the final output stage. It comprises two independent four-bit binary counters each having a clear and a clock input. N-bit binary counters can be implemented with each package providing the capability of divide-by-256. It has parallel outputs from each counter stage so that any submultiple of the input count frequency is available for system-timing signals.
- Direct clear for each 4bit counter
- Buffered outputs reduce possibility of collector commutation
